“The end of an era” Poyet defends Mourinho

Former Tottenham star Gus Poyet believes that his old side have ultimately come to an end of an era and must rebuild.

Spurs opted to sack Mauricio Pochettino in November, with Jose Mourinho appointed as his successor.

Although that led to an upturn in form following his arrival, things haven’t gone to plan for Tottenham this season as they could end up empty-handed while possibly missing out on Champions League qualification.

Time will tell if the season is completed amid the coronavirus crisis, but Poyet has defended Mourinho while insisting that injuries have hurt them this season, as has the need to now potentially rebuild to start a new cycle.

“I think it is the end of an era, the end of a process,” Poyet told Goal. “At certain places, you can manage the process in a way by slowly changing.

“There are other places where you hang onto a team until the end and then you feel like you have to change everything. I think Tottenham is in that place at the moment. This defends every manager in the world, not only Jose Mourinho.

“The players normally like the change; then reality comes back on the players. It will be an important end of the season for Spurs but even more so in the market after. I think they have a plan.”

Should the campaign resume, Spurs will be looking at a seven-point gap to fourth-placed Chelsea with nine games remaining, while they crashed out of the FA Cup and Champions League prior to the suspension of fixtures.

However, Mourinho will be likely boosted by the return to fitness of Harry Kane and Heung-Min Son among others, and so they’ll be hoping to salvage something from the season if it can be completed.
